National Seeds Hosting:

#2 Florida
#3 Arkansas
#4 LSU
#7 Vandy
#9 Kentucky
#12 Auburn
#14 Alabama

7 hosts!

Other SEC Teams in:
South Carolina (#2 seed at Coastal Carolina)
Tennessee (#2 seed at Miami)
Texas A&M (#3 seed at Texas)

Alabama is 8-2 since they fired Bohannon. They’ve won their last three SEC series. An RPI of 14. They are 16-14 in SEC play and 38-17 overall. They were 12-1 in mid-week games. The only “really bad losses” you could attribute are losing a series to Columbia in March. Maybe you’re talking about a sweep at LSU. But every metric suggests Alabama should be in the conversation to host.
